Output ef60422e04ca9ee7757463b248d15b570e0ba57475bcc8f2adadcefb21ff7dd8:4

value
27490890
script pubkey
OP_0 OP_PUSHBYTES_20 8e8339bf27ef55173bb12a34a84a0ed29c75d386
address
ltc1q36pnn0e8aa23wwa39g62sjsw62w8t5uxdfm5qw
transaction
ef60422e04ca9ee7757463b248d15b570e0ba57475bcc8f2adadcefb21ff7dd8
spent
true